Vicki Farnell is a dedicated therapist and part-owner at Lighthouse Therapy. She is passionate about supporting birthing people, parents, and adults on their journeys toward understanding, healing, and growth. Drawing from a variety of theoretical frameworks, Vicki tailors her approach to meet the unique needs of each client and family. Her practice is holistic, integrating both left- and right-brain processes and somatic experiences to foster deeper healing. At the core of her work are the principles of attachment and authentic connection.
Vicki completed her Master’s of Arts in Counselling Psychology in 2012 and holds a post-graduate certificate in Complex Trauma from the Justice Institute of BC, where she discovered her deep commitment to helping survivors of childhood trauma find validation, clarity, and healing. She is trained in Eye Movement Desensitization and Reprocessing (EMDR) and uses this powerful modality to support individuals living with PTSD and C-PTSD. Her work is client-centered, offering both steady support and gentle guidance along the healing path.
A significant part of Vicki’s work centers on perinatal mental health. She is especially passionate about supporting birthing individuals and their families as they navigate pregnancy, postpartum mood disorders, and birth trauma. Vicki has received specialized training from Postpartum Support International, Pacific Postpartum Support Society, and Canadian Perinatal Mental Health. As a mother of two, she understands firsthand the intensity of early parenting and the emotional challenges it can bring. She works one-on-one with clients and also serves as a faculty member with Canadian Perinatal Mental Health Trainings, educating practitioners across Canada. Additionally, she facilitates an ongoing postpartum support group within the community.
Vicki brings extensive experience working with parent-child dyads to help strengthen and rebuild connections. She helps parents understand their children through the lens of attachment, guiding them to recognize personal triggers and develop new, empowered ways of relating. Vicki is trained in Modified Interaction Guidance, Connect Parenting, and Circle of Security. She has woven these approaches into a dynamic parenting program that delivers practical tools and deep insights, helping families grow closer and communicate more effectively.
